Está en la página 1de 33

UNIVERSIDAD NACIONAL DE

TRUJILLO
Ingeniera de Sistemas
La Lgica Difusa permite a los
sistemas trabajar con informacin
que no es exacta, es decir dicha
informacin contiene un alto grado
de imprecisin, contrario a la lgica
tradicional que trabaja con
informacin definida y precisa.
Un conjunto
difuso se
encuentra
asociado por
un valor
lingstico que
est definido
por una
palabra,
etiqueta o
adjetivo.
= ,

|
En los Conjuntos Difusos la funcin de
pertenencia puede tomar valores del
intervalo entre 0 y 1, y la transmisin del
valor entre cero y uno no cambia de
manera instantnea como pasa con los
conjuntos clsicos.
Un Conjunto Difuso en
un universo puede
definirse con la siguiente
ecuacin:
Donde:

: x -> [0,1] es la funcin de


Pertenencia

es el grado de pertenencia de la
variable x.
es el universo en discurso.
Entre ms cerca est A del valor 1,
mayor ser la pertenencia del objeto
x al conjunto A.
Las funciones de pertenencia
nos permiten representar
grficamente un conjunto difuso.
En el eje x (abscisas) se
representa el universo en discurso.
En el eje y (ordenadas) se sitan
los grados de pertenencia en el
intervalo [0,1].
=

< <

< <


; <

>

; =


La FUNCIN DE PERTENENCIA de un elemento x
se puede calcular de la siguiente manera:
Para funciones Triangulares:




1
()


x
0
Para funciones Triangulares:
=

< <

< <

< <

; <

>


Para funciones Trapezoidales:
Para funciones Trapezoidales:
1
()
0


x
Grfico General:
Un control difuso es una
alternativa prctica para
resolver una variedad
de complejas
aplicaciones de control,
ya que propone un
mtodo para construir
controles No Lineales a
travs de informacin
heurstica.
DATOS
DE
SALIDA
DATOS
DE
ENTRADA
La Fusificacin
tiene como objetivo
convertir valores
reales en valores
finitos.

Se asignan grados
de pertenencia a
cada una de las
variables de
entrada.
La Base de
Conocimiento
contiene el
conocimiento
asociado con el
dominio de la
aplicacin y los
objetivos del
control.
En esta etapa se deben definir las reglas lingsticas de control que realizaran la toma
de decisiones que a su vez decidirn la forma en la que debe actuar el sistema.
La inferencia es el proceso
mediante el cual se genera un
mapeo para asignar a una entrada
una salida utilizando Lgica Difusa.
El proceso de Inferencia provee
las bases para la toma de
decisiones del sistema.
Este proceso involucra la
utilizacin de funciones de
pertenencia y la reglas
generadas en la base de
conocimiento.
Existen diferentes mtodos de inferencia, los ms
comunes son los de Mamdani y Takagi-Sugeno-Kang
* Utiliza reglas tipo si-entonces (if-else).
* Una regla de la base de reglas o base de
conocimiento tiene dos partes, el ANTECEDENTE Y
LA CONCLUSIN.
En un sistema difuso tipo Mandani
tanto el antecedente como el
consecuente de las reglas estn dados
por expresiones lingsticas.
IF la entrada es baja THEN la salida es Alta
Antecedente
Consecuente
* Los valores que arrojan los consecuentes de las
diferentes reglas que se han activado en un momento
determinado ya son valores numricos por lo que no
se necesita una etapa de Defusificacin .
En un sistema difuso tipo Sugeno el
consecuente de estas reglas ya no es una
etiqueta lingstica sino una funcin de
entrada que tenga el sistema en un
momento dado.
IF la entrada es baja THEN la salida = F(entrada)
Antecedente
Consecuente
DEFUSIFICACIN

Es la conclusin difusa obtenida en
la inferencia .

Esta variable lingstica posee
valores que han sido asignados por
grados de pertenencia, sin embargo
usualmente necesitamos un escalar
que corresponda a estos grados de
pertenencia.
MTODO DEL CENTROIDE
MTODO PROMEDIO MXIMO
MTODO PROMEDIO PONDERADO
MTODO DE MEMBRESA DEL MEDIO
DEL MXIMO
MTODO PROMEDIO MXIMO
0 60 70 80 90 100 20 40 50 30 10
0.0
1.0
0.5
Figura2.7 Mtodo promedio mximo
MTODO PROMEDIO
PONDERADO
Donde:

n = nmero de mximos.

xmax = valor de x del mximo.

(xmax) = es le valor de pertenencia del mximo.


Trabajaremos con la figura 2.7
MTODO DE CENTROIDE
Es el ms utilizado por los
ingenieros de control
Este mtodo tambin conocido
como Centro de rea(COA) calcula
el centro de gravedad del polgono
que se gener en la inferencia [8]
TCNICAS FUZZY EN SISTEMAS EXPERTOS:
La Incertidumbre como control de inferencia.

Uno de los aspectos ms importantes de la
investigacin en sistemas expertos es progresar en
nuestro conocimiento acerca de la capacidad del ser
humano para resolver problemas difciles.
La experiencia de un experto posibilita
utilizar mejores estrategias de resolucin.
Forman parte de lo que
denominaremos
meta-conocimiento, es decir
conocimiento acerca de como utilizar
los conocimientos necesarios para
resolver un problema.
Es posible representar y usar meta-conocimiento mediante
estrategias de control
Focalizar
el problema
Controlar
la inferencia
Controlar
acciones
Por ejemplo:
Descripcin que hace un mdico
Inicialmente considero los factores de riesgo ya que
permiten localizar un conjunto inicial de hiptesis
plausibles, a continuacin tengo en cuenta los datos clnicos
observables directamente para validar o rechazar hiptesis
del conjunto inicial; finalmente considero datos de
laboratorio y radiologa para tomar decisiones finales.
EL CONTROL DE LA INFERENCIA EN SISTEMAS EXPERTOS
El procedimiento de resolucin de problemas en sistemas
expertos basados en reglas consiste en la activacin de
reglas partiendo de un
conjunto inicial de hechos conocidos.
La aplicacin de una regla puede causar la
activacin de otras reglas resultando en lo que se
denomina ENCADENAMIENTO DE REGLAS
(HACIA ADELANTE /HACIA ATRS)
Un sistema experto no trivial contiene muchos
centenares, incluso algunos miles de reglas y
generalmente varias de ellas pueden ser aplicables
en un momento dado.
EL CONTROL DE LA INFERENCIA EN SISTEMAS EXPERTOS
SI:
El estado del paciente es grave
Tiene la presin baja
Est bajo shock sptico
ENTONCES:
Concluir neumona es bacteriana
(posible)
SI:
La neumona es extrahospitalaria
El paciente tiene contacto frecuente con
pjaros
La neumona es bacteriana
ENTONCES:
Neumococo (bastante posible)
Por ejemplo:
EL CONTROL DE LA INFERENCIA EN SISTEMAS EXPERTOS
El Sistema experto debe poseer un mecanismo de control
para decidir qu regla conviene aplicar de entre las
aplicables
Codificado implcitamente Representado explcitamente
El orden de introduccin de las reglas es
determinante para llegar o no llegar a la
solucin
No son flexibles
Falta de focalizacin hacia el objetivo
ms adecuado
Permite al sistema Razonar
sobre qu reglas es ms
conveniente
Son flexibles
Focalizacin hacia el objetivo
mediante estrategias de control
MODULARIDAD Y LOCALIDAD
Eficiencia

No disponibilidad de
todos los datos
Los expertos humanos usan
generalmente solamente una
parte de sus conocimientos
del dominio para resolver un
problema concreto.
La modularizacin introduce
el concepto de localidad en la
Base de Conocimientos. Es
posible definir el contenido
de un mdulo
independientemente del resto
de mdulos.
Pueden organizarse jerrquicamente

Conjunto de declaraciones de:

Hechos importados, hechos exportados,
reglas, metareglas y submdulos
ELICITACIN DE OPERADORES SOBRE TRMINOS LINGSTICOS
El problema de usar
el intervalo [0,1]:
El caso en que dichos operadores para
conectivos lgicos se aplican a un conjunto
finito de valores de certeza
El experto no es capaz de definir exactamente el
significado de los trminos utilizando una escala
numrica.
Los expertos no muestran un alto grado de
acuerdo sobre la representacin de un trmino
concreto.
ELICITACIN DE OPERADORES SOBRE TRMINOS LINGSTICOS
Solucin:
Considerar los trminos como valores de
verdad en una lgica multivaluada,
conservndose la flexibilidad.
Considerar los trminos como elementos
ordenados de un conjunto
Utilizar las propiedades a verificar por los
operadores como un conjunto de restricciones.
Actan sobre el espacio de posibles
combinaciones (Y, O, IMPLICACIN)
entre los trminos lingsticos.
Otro trmino lingstico como resultado
ELICITACIN DE OPERADORES SOBRE TRMINOS LINGSTICOS
Solucin:
Considerar los trminos como valores de
verdad en una lgica multivaluada,
conservndose la flexibilidad.
Considerar los trminos como elementos
ordenados de un conjunto
Utilizar las propiedades a verificar por los
operadores como un conjunto de restricciones.
Actan sobre el espacio de posibles
combinaciones (Y, O, IMPLICACIN)
entre los trminos lingsticos.
Otro trmino lingstico como resultado

También podría gustarte